Solution Overview
Problem
Conventional systems are ineffective in discovering new, high-quality digital content and artists due to reliance on low-level features and lack of mechanisms for identifying content without social indicators, leading to 'cold start' issues where newly uploaded content is undiscovered.
Innovation Solution
The system analyzes raw image data using machine learning quality models to identify high-quality content and artists based on features and descriptors, enabling real-time or near-real-time identification during image capture and promoting such content through platforms like Flickr and Instagram.

Data Source
AI summary
Disclosed are systems and methods for improving interactions with and between computers in a content generating, hosting and/or providing system supported by or configured with personal computing devices, servers and/or platforms. The systems interact to identify and retrieve data across platforms, which can be used to improve the quality of data used in processing interactions between or among processors in such systems. The disclosed systems and methods provide systems and methods for automatic discovery of high quality digital content. According to embodiments, the present disclosure describes improved computer system and methods directed to analyzing raw image data, such as features and descriptors of images in order to identify a high quality image(s). Such images can be identified from a database of images, and such images can be identified in real-time, or near real-time during the capture of an image(s) by a camera.
